PPC (Pay Per Click)
PPC campaigns offer businesses a highly measurable and controllable way to reach their target audience, drive website traffic, generate leads, and increase conversions. It is an essential part of many digital marketing strategies and offers businesses the flexibility to set their budgets and optimize campaigns based on real-time performance data.
React JS Application Development in San Diego
UX/UI Research and Design
Both UX and UI design collaborate closely to ensure that the digital product not only looks appealing but also provides a delightful user experience. Together, they play a critical role in driving user engagement, retention, and satisfaction, making them essential components of successful digital product development.
In the context of the digital world, ADA compliance focuses on making websites, web applications, and other digital content accessible to individuals with visual, auditory, cognitive, or motor impairments. This involves designing and developing digital assets in a way that accommodates a diverse range of users, including those who use screen readers, have limited mobility, or experience other challenges.
Whiteboard animations are often used for educational purposes, explainer videos, training materials, and marketing campaigns. The simplicity and visual appeal of whiteboard animations make them highly effective in retaining viewers' attention and improving message retention. They combine visuals with narration or voiceovers to deliver information in a memorable and entertaining way, making them a popular choice for businesses, educators, and content creators looking to communicate their ideas effectively to their target audience.
Expert Witness in Technology
Our Expert witnesses in tech services are commonly used in various software testing contexts, such as unit testing, integration testing, and end-to-end testing. It is especially valuable in complex testing scenarios where multiple systems or components interact, and a verification mechanism is needed to ensure that the test outcomes are valid and consistent to determine whether or not parameters were indeed met.
Web development involves integrating various technologies, frameworks, and APIs to create dynamic, responsive, and scalable web solutions that meet specific business or user needs. It is a constantly evolving field, and web developers must stay up-to-date with the latest trends and best practices to deliver high-quality, secure, and performant websites and web applications for a wide range of industries and users.
A Content Management System (CMS) is a software application or platform that allows users to create, manage, and publish digital content on websites or online applications without requiring in-depth technical knowledge. CMS platforms offer a user-friendly interface, often with a "What You See Is What You Get" (WYSIWYG) editor, enabling users to write and format content easily.
Web Architectural Design
A well-designed web architecture lays the foundation for a reliable, user-friendly, and high-performance digital experience. Key considerations in web architectural design include choosing the right technology stack, determining data storage and retrieval methods, establishing communication protocols between different components, and optimizing the overall performance to deliver seamless user experiences.
Mobile Application Development
Mobile app development is the process of creating software applications specifically designed to run on mobile devices, such as smartphones and tablets. Mobile apps offer a wide range of functionalities and are developed for various platforms, including iOS (Apple's operating system) and Android (Google's operating system). The development process involves several stages, including planning, design, development, testing, and deployment.
API design, short for Application Programming Interface design, refers to the process of defining and structuring the interfaces that allow different software systems to communicate and interact with each other. APIs serve as the bridge between different applications, enabling them to exchange data and functionality seamlessly.
Legacy updates refer to the process of modernizing or improving outdated software systems or applications that have been in use for an extended period. Legacy systems often present challenges due to their obsolete technologies, outdated architectures, and lack of compatibility with current industry standards.